Assistant professor position at UBC in Vancouver, Canada
Job Description
Overview
Tenure-track faculty position in Physical Oceanography with a strong commitment to multi-disciplinary research.
Responsibilities
The successful candidate will be expected to effectively teach undergraduate and graduate courses in oceanography, climate or environmental sciences offered by the Department of Earth and Ocean Sciences.
Qualifications
The candidate should have a Ph.D. in physical oceanography, preferably post-doctoral research experience, and a strong commitment to the multi-disciplinary study of the physical dynamics which drive important biogeochemical and/or climate processes in the oceans.
